Other … Author: Steven Lamb MBChB, Department of Dermatology, Waikato Hospital, … WebbPruritus is the medical name for itching. Drug-induced pruritus is an itch caused or triggered by medication. There are various itchy drug eruptions, but generally, the term ‘drug-induced pruritus’ implies that no primary rash is present — just scratch marks.
